摘要: 1.从封装角度看。这样的方法签名,表达能力不强,没交代清楚输入,调用者需要了解被调用代码细节,才能知道需要给哪些属性赋值。如果不同程序集,不同人员一同开发会有不小沟通障碍,一旦被调用方法参数有变要通知调用方,否则可能出现bug。2.从接口角度看。基于第一点,很难形成接口,因为接口功能之一是定义输入输出的规范。3.从维护角度看。首先,代码是你自己写的,自然觉得问题不大,但是如果别人来做代码的维护,单... 阅读全文
posted @ 2015-11-27 13:47 CaryFang 阅读(1003) 评论(0) 推荐(0) 编辑